    after daily long term use a canvas strop might need some cleaning.what i do with very good result is to use barber soap and a boar brush.work up lather on the strop and use the brush well.let it rest some minutes and rine of the latter. put it between a towel and squees out most of the water.then let it dry. mine looked as new after this treatment.

    I have several linen strop components in need of cleaning. In the past, I've used a mild detergent such as Woolite® in COLD water, mild scrubbing with a bristle brush and rinse.
    Hang dry in the sun using one of these old wooden pants hangers.
